If you only need the memory as long as the program is running (which is often
the case), you can just use an insertmem/delmem pair, inserting memory at the
end of your program. Then have a label at the end of the program, and use it
to address the allocated memory.

Another thing Phelan, are you loading this data from an external program
file? Because in that case you could just look the program up, and it'd
already be in memory! If you don't, you could try to redesign the program to
work in this way, as it saves memory.
